Docker卷管理可以通过以下方法简化流程:
创建Docker卷
使用 docker volume create
命令创建卷,例如:
docker volume create my_volume
挂载Docker卷到容器
使用 -v
或 --mount
选项将卷挂载到容器中,例如:
docker run -d --name my_container -v my_volume:/path/in/container my_image
查看和管理Docker卷
使用 docker volume ls
查看所有卷,使用 docker volume inspect
查看特定卷的详细信息,使用 docker volume rm
删除卷。
数据卷容器
创建一个数据卷容器,以便多个容器可以共享和访问数据卷。
数据卷备份
创建一个新的容器,挂载数据卷容器,挂载宿主机本地目录作为数据卷,将数据卷容器的内容备份到宿主机本地目录挂载的数据卷中。
使用可视化工具
使用可视化工具如Portainer、LazyDocker和DockerUI来更方便地查看和管理Docker卷。
通过上述方法,可以有效地简化Docker卷管理的流程,提高工作效率。